Nightdive Studios, the developer behind the remake of 1994 classic System Shock, recently shared some pre-alpha footage featuring artwork that’ll appear in the final game.

The two-and-a-half minute clip showcases the game’s protagonist traversing various corridors of a large space station, just like in the original. This time around, however, the graphics have been enhanced significantly, creating an eerie yet modern atmosphere that begs to be explored.

Nightdive also shared some additional static artwork that its developers have been working on including lounge areas for Citadel employees and a vegetation system to create overgrowth in other areas as well as various ship components like outer panels and windows.

Nightdive’s remake of System Shock hit Kickstarter in 2016 but the project was put on hold last February after raising $1.3 million. Fortunately, the game wasn’t on hiatus for very long, allowing development to continue albeit with a condensed team.
